Gear
shaping is a multipoint machining
process for generating teeth by a
reciprocating cutter. Gear shaping
is one of the most versatile of all
gear cutting operations. This
cutting process uses a gear-shaped
cutter that is reciprocated and
rotated, in relationship to a blank,
to produce the gear teeth. Cutters
rotate in timed relationship with
the workpiece. Finally Gear Shaping
produces internal gears, external
gears, and integral gear-pinion
arrangements. |
